Another epic backyard transformation we completed by building a new screen porch in this previously boring backyard. Full time lapse of the entire construction process of this covered deck screen porch along with an epic before and after at the end. We show you the entire build process of this backyard transformation including footings all the way through framing to finishes. This backyard is now an awesome spot to hang out with a screen porch featuring a huge fireplace wall and an open deck with an outdoor kitchen. We also install a paver walkway from the screen porch out to the driveway!
